How does the arrangement of particles determine the physical properties of different states of matter?​
Usimov [2.4K]

Answer:

See explanation

Explanation:

Matter may exist in three phases; solid, liquid and gas. The state in which matter exists depends on the extent of intermolecular forces operating in the substance.

In solid particles, the molecules that compose the solid are close together because the molecules of a solid do not move from place to place but they continue to vibrate about their fixed position.

For liquids, the molecules that compose a liquid are in random motion but are less energetic than molecules of a gas.

In gases, the molecules are not held together at all. The molecules of a gas have the highest degree of freedom. They move from one point another at a high velocity.

Hence, the order of increasing degree of movement of the particles in different states of matter = solids<liquids< gases.

Solids have well arranged particles, the molecules of a liquid are a little more disorderly than liquid particles while gas particles are the most disorderly of all the states of matter.
